012132
شنبه 28 اردیبهشت 1392, 17:49 عصر
با سلام . می خواستم بدونم چطور میشه توی C# از اجرای یک کلید مثلاً (Alt+F4) جلوگیری کرد و وقتی که کاربر این کلید رو زد کاری انجام نشه یا مثلاً یه پیغام نمایش داده بشه ؟
من با استفاده از کد زیر سعی کردم ، اما علاوه بر پیغامی که نمایش داده میشه ، پنجره هم بسته میشه ، اما من نمی خوام فرمم بسته بشه :
private void Form1_KeyDown(object sender, KeyEventArgs e)
{
if ((e.Alt == true) && (e.KeyCode == Keys.F4)) MessageBox.Show("u Cant close This window");
}
لطفاً راهنماییم کنید .
من با استفاده از کد زیر سعی کردم ، اما علاوه بر پیغامی که نمایش داده میشه ، پنجره هم بسته میشه ، اما من نمی خوام فرمم بسته بشه :
private void Form1_KeyDown(object sender, KeyEventArgs e)
{
if ((e.Alt == true) && (e.KeyCode == Keys.F4)) MessageBox.Show("u Cant close This window");
}
لطفاً راهنماییم کنید .